COMM 320 Mass Media Law (3)<br />

Examines the law as it affects the mass media. Discusses such areas as libel, privacy, public<br />

records, criminal pretrial publicity, freedom of information and obscenity. Prerequisite:<br />

COMM 101.<br />

COMM 325 Mass Communication and Society (3)<br />

Provides students with an overview of the effect of media on culture and society. The course<br />

explores how media reflect and mould culture. It examines the role the media play in creating<br />

the global village. It also examines how the audience uses and is used by various media outlets<br />

and how that use affects the perception of various cultures. Prerequisite: COMM 101.<br />

COMM 328 Media and Democratization (3)<br />

Media’s role in processes of democratization in Europe, Asia, and the Americas. Current<br />

debates and initiatives to make mass media systems more democratic. Prerequisites: COMM<br />

101, COMM 225.<br />

COMM 332 Writing/Editing Opinion Edit (3)<br />

Principles of writing editorials and opinion columns; policies and practices of opinion writing<br />

in mass media; reviews; analysis of editorials, Op-Ed and other commentary. Prerequisite:<br />

COMM 201.<br />

COMM 333 Writing Speeches and Delivery (3)<br />

The preparation and delivery of speeches and presentations, from research and writing to<br />

practical delivery. Prerequisite: ENGL 108.<br />

COMM 338 Copywriting for Advertising (3)<br />

Explores issues, strategies, theories and practices in writing and editing advertising messages.<br />

Teaches the technical aspects of advertising: writing advertising copy and designing effective<br />

layouts. Students use their software design skills. Prerequisite: COMM 230.<br />

COMM 350 Organizational Communication and Leadership (3)<br />

Teaches students the role of communication in creating a productive organizational<br />

environment in terms of interpersonal and group behavior. Reviews the theory and practice<br />

of team building, conflict resolution and problem solving and explores how communication<br />

and organizational cultures relate to each other. Prerequisite: COMM 101 or MGMT 201 or<br />

Permission of Instructor. [Cross-listed with MGMT 350].<br />
